Start by rethinking your layout. Rearranging furniture to create clear walkways often dramatically improves how large a room feels. Consider removing bulky or rarely used items and opting for pieces with legs that show more floor space. Mirrors, too, are powerful tools—they reflect natural light and visually expand smaller rooms. Smart storage solutions can also transform your home. Built-in shelves, under-bed storage, and multifunctional furniture keep clutter at bay—helping your home feel more open. A calm and organized environment not only improves daily living but enhances overall enjoyment of your home. Lighting and color also play major roles in perceived space. Soft neutral walls, bright lighting, and streamlined window treatments open up any room.
